Birth*1863 John was born at Dooly Co., Georgia, in 1863.2,1 
 He was the son of David Culpepper and Argent Sutton
1870 Census1 Jun 1870 Argent, William, Mary, Eliza, Adelia, Sarah, Dovie, John and Susan listed as a household member living with David Culpepper on the 1870 Census at Dooly Co., Georgia.3 
1880 Census1 Jun 1880 John was listed as a son in David Culpepper's household on the 1880 Census at Dooly Co., Georgia.2 
Marriage*6 Feb 1888 He married Lydia Ava Williams at Dooly Co., Georgia, on 6 Feb 1888.4 
Death*1893 He died at Dooly Co., Georgia, in 1893. John Elbert Culpepper was murdered by a man with whom he had had a dispute. He was murdered at his home which is up the hill across Cedar Creek from Ebenezer Church where he and many family members are buried..1 
Burial*1893 His body was interred in 1893 at Ebenezer Cemetery, Cordele, Crisp Co., Georgia.1 
Administration*4 Sep 1893 After John's death, Lydia Ava Culpepper was appointed administrator of the estate. On 4 Sep 1893 at Dooly Co., Georgia, (Lydia A. Culpepper granted Letters of Administration on the estate of John E. Culpepper, dec'd.).5
